USAGE-PURPOSES NAVEX monitors radar data and estimates the velocity and position of the space shuttle MONITORING FXAA Provides auditing assistance in foreign exchange trading locating irregular transactions INTERPRETATION GUIDON instructs medical students on antimicrobial therapy for bacterial infections INSTRUCTION NEAT infers system malfunctioning of data processing and telecommunications network equipment DIAGNOSIS PEACE is an expert system developed to assist engineers in the design of an electronic circuit DESIGN VM monitors a patient in an intensive care unit and controls the treatment CONTROL

USAGE-PURPOSES STEAMER simulates and explains the operation of the Navyâs 1078-class frigate system propulsion plant to aspiring NAVAL engineers SIMULATION IREX assists in the selection of industrial robots in a work environment. It identifies the best choice from a list of possibilities SELECTION BLUE BOX recommends an appropriate therapy for patients suffering from depression PRESCRIPTION PLANT predicts the damage to corn caused by the invasion of black cutworms PREDICTION PLANPOWER provides a wide range of financial plans for households in the areas of cash management PLANNING
